New stable version 1.1.0 released
08 February 2015

We’re proud to announce the arrival of the next major version 1.1.0 of Roundcube webmail which is now available for download. With this milestone we introduce new features since version 1.0 as well as some clean-up with the 3rd party libraries:

    Allow searching across multiple folders
    Improved support for screen readers and assistive technology using WCAG 2.0 and WAI ARIA standards
    Update to TinyMCE 4.1 to support images in HTML signatures (copy & paste)
    Added namespace filter and folder searching in folder manager
    New config option to disable UI elements/actions
    Stronger password encryption using OpenSSL
    Support for the IMAP SPECIAL-USE extension
    Support for Oracle as database backend
    Manage 3rd party libs with Composer

In addition to that, we added some new features to improve protection against possible but yet unknown CSRF attacks - thanks to the help of Kolab Systems who supplied the concept and development resources for this.

Although the new security features are yet experimental and disabled by default, our wiki describes how to enable the Secure URLs and give it a try.

And of course, this new version also includes all patches for reported CSRF and XSS vulnerabilities previously released in the 1.0.x series.

IMPORTANT: with the 1.1.x series, we drop support for PHP < 5.3.7 and Internet Explorer < 9. IE7/IE8 support can be restored by enabling the ‘legacy_browser’ plugin.
